For high school through adult baseball gloves range from 11.25” to 12.25”. What size glove you should use largely depends on the position you play, but there are also other factors that help determine exactly which glove you should equip yourself with. Fastpitch infield gloves range from 11” to 12”. Outfielders need larger gloves to cover more ground, typically ranging from 12 to 12.75 inches.
